Position Title: Upward Bound Student Leader Supervisor - Residential

Department: Ctr Student Success and Retention

Advertised Pay: $3,150.00 for the seven week program plus the program pays for room, board, and weekly field trip travel expenses, including all admission fees.

Campus Location: Washburn University

Special Instructions to Applicants: Successful applicant must pass a fingerprint background check by May 27, paid for with WUB funds and complete CPR, First Aid, and AED training, paid for with WUB funds.

Position Summary: Upward Bound is looking for a student supervisor to facilitate the academic, social and cultural enrichment of high school participants by supervising the residential staff who act as mentors, role models, and guides to participants attending a six week residential summer camp on Washburn's campus.

Essential Functions:
-Live in residence hall, providing supervision to residential student leaders and all program participants in general. Assist residential staff in establishing and maintaining positive, respectful, mentoring relationships with assigned group in particular and all other participants. Develop, implement, and supervise a six-week schedule of recreational and social activities. Supervise entire population during short and extended field trips.

-Establish positive relationships with parents/guardians of program participants. Assign duty roster responsibilities (dining hall supervision, on-call duty, hall duty, supervising evening activities, miscellaneous errands, etc.). Conduct weekly meetings with summer student leader staff to implement activities that increase group cohesion, address particular group concerns, and promote open communication. Assist in planning and implementing weekly dorm meetings with program participants.

-Clarify, monitor adherence to, and enforce UB and Washburn University program policies and procedures with particular attention to rules governing student conduct. Conduct fire drills, tornado drills, building and room inspections, and ID checks. Monitor visitor access to residence hall as well as participant movement in and out of the building and between floors. Attend daily meetings with Program Advisor. Conduct weekly staff meetings and nightly updates with student leaders. Collect participant behavior reports from student leaders; submit weekly activity reports summarizing behavior reports. Develop cohesive relationships with the instructors and tutors.

-Assure that participants complete homework. Provide mentoring support in academic classroom, only when invited by the teacher. Assist in monitoring student behavior during on and off-campus activities. Adhere to Washburn University residential living policies and social media policies.

-Other responsibilities as assigned by the Upward Bound Advisor or Program Director.

Required Qualifications:
-Junior class standing at Washburn University by the end of the Spring Term 2025 with a verified 2.50 cumulative GPA.
-Attend Training May 28-30 on Washburn campus; At end of year - Houston, TX Cultural Trip July 11-15 (additional weeks pay of $450 will be added).
-Experience working with high school aged students. Commitment to helping students succeed in higher education.
-English proficiency (verbal, reading, and writing).
-Must be a U.S. Citizen.
-Experience living in a residence hall.
-Demonstrated maturity in use of appropriate leadership, communication, social, and role modeling skills.
-Must be able to work the all training days, 6 weeks of camp, Sunday evening through early Friday afternoon (Participants go home every Friday afternoon and return Sunday evening for dinner and activities).
-Must pass a fingerprint background check, paid for by the program.
-Must be CPR certified. The program will pay for CPR, First Aid, and AED certification. Certifications must be completed before training on May 28.

Preferred Qualifications:
-Managerial experience.
-A valid driver's license with a good driving record.
